Phantom Pearl
- A Jewel Intrigue Novel, Book 3
- By: Monica McCabe
- Narrated by: Asia King
- Length: 11 hrs and 8 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Riki Maddox is not your average tomb-raiding treasure hunter. Her targets are carefully chosen to wound her father’s killers, the Japanese Yakuza. Working for the Department of Homeland Security, Special Agent Dallas Landry is a rare breed. He had a perfect success rate recovering stolen art and antiquities—until he came up against a menace known as Riki Maddox. The two will cross paths once again in Australia—on a quest for the legendary Phantom Pearl, a priceless mammoth tusk carved by 15th century monks.

The Errant Earl
- By: Amanda McCabe
- Narrated by: Laura Greaves
- Length: 5 hrs and 18 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
When Marcus Hadley’s father remarries an actress after his mother’s death, he leaves home bitter. Years later, when his father and stepmother are killed tragically, he must return to fulfill his duties as the new Earl. He wants to make amends for his absence to the daughter left from the actress’ first marriage. To his surprise, he discovers a beautiful and unique young woman, who immediately excites his interest with her joie de vivre. Anna, on the other hand, fears the return of the angry young man who hated her mother.

The Origin of Religion
- By: Joseph McCabe
- Narrated by: Oberon Michaels
- Length: 1 hr and 21 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Much of the writing by secular scholar Joseph McCabe was devoted to the de-mystifying of organized religion. In this trenchant essay, McCabe seeks to disprove the assumption that the religious instinct in humanity was evident from the earliest days of civilization, and that the search for spiritual revelation was one of the primary activities of primitive societies.
